About:
Ather Energy was started in 2013 by Tarun Mehta and Swapnil Jain, two engineering graduates straight out of college with the audacity to dream and challenge the well-established Internal Combustion Engine (ICE) and replace it with an electric drive.
They built India’s first smart and connected electric scooters, the Ather 450 product line, because they believe that’s where the future of personal mobility is headed.
Ather is one of the few companies in India, specifically within the automotive industry, to have products and services that amalgamate clean design and engineering – Hardware and software.
Today, their product offerings include the Ather Rizta, Ather 450X, Ather 450S, Public and Private charging Infrastructure, Accessories and Merch, and innovative ownership plans. They are also building a complete ecosystem for India’s electric vehicles – powered by indigenous design and all locally manufactured.
